Resumo: The adaptation of spaces to different usage typologies can be complex in heritage buildings, especially when it comes to achieving thermal comfort in readapted buildings. This paper shows the thermal comfort assessment performed in office spaces located in a historic building in the University of Coimbra, Portugal. Objective and subjective data were acquired during a monitoring campaign carried out between May and September 2020 to assess indoor conditions' quality in such offices. Due to the current pandemic of COVID-19, offices were not occupied at full capacity. The data presented in the article are related to the research article entitled “Barriers on establishing passive strategies in office spaces: a case study in a historic university building” [1], which presents a full investigation of the thermal comfort conditions of workers in this building during the cooling season.
